Nutrition in Pediatric Intensive Care Units

Öz:
The limited energy stores and fast metabolism of sick children in the intensive care unit, as well as the intense stress caused by the critical illness, reveal the importance of nutrition. Adequate and balanced nutritional care for critically ill children improves the clinical course and prognosis. In order to provide appropriate nutritional support, it is important to evaluate the nutritional status of the critical patient in detail and integrity. In the critically ill child with a functioning gastrointestinal tract, the enteral route is preferable to parenteral nutrition. In cases where the digestive system is not used completely or adequately, parenteral nutrition should be applied.

Çocuk Yoğun Bakım Ünitelerinde Beslenme

Öz:
Çocuk yoğun bakım ünitelerinde izlenen kritik hasta çocukların kısıtlı enerji depoları ve hızlı metabolizmaları yanı sıra kritik hastalığın yarattığı yoğun stres durumu beslenmenin önemini ortaya koymaktadır. Kritik hasta çocuklara yönelik yeterli ve dengeli nutrisyonel bakım hastalık sürecini olumlu yönde etkiler. Uygun beslenme desteğinin sağlanabilmesi için kritik hastanın beslenme durumunun değerlendirilmesinin ayrıntılı ve bütünlük içerisinde yapılması önemlidir. Sindirim sistemi işlev gören kritik hasta bir çocukta enteral yol parenteral beslenmeye tercih edilmelidir. Sindirim sisteminin tümüyle ya da yeterince kullanılmadığı durumlarda ise parenteral beslenmeye başvurulmalıdır.
